OPM DELIVERS 696 IRON SHEETS TO SOROTI TO SUPPORT STORM-AFFECTED SCHOOLS, CHURCHES, AND RESIDENCES

The Office of the Prime Minister (OPM) has donated a total of 696 iron sheets to Soroti District to support the roofing of public that were recently destroyed by heavy winds and storms.

The consignment was officially delivered to the Soroti District headquarters on Friday, July 18, 2025. The donation targets several institutions and individuals whose buildings suffered major damage due to the recent extreme weather conditions.

Beneficiaries of this government intervention include Omugenya Primary School, which will use the iron sheets to roof a staff house, Olio-Kamuda Primary School for the roofing of a teacher's house, roofing of a teacher’s house in Obyarai Primary and Takaramiam Primary school.

Other recipients include Global Harvest Church, which lost its roof during the storms, the residential house of Bishop Emeritus Echeru, and the home of Rev. Ekilu John. Additional individuals and institutions also benefited from the relief support.

While receiving the materials on behalf of the district, Mr. Moses Esatu, the Acting Principal Assistant Secretary (Ag. PAS), commended the Office of the Prime Minister for responding swiftly to the community’s urgent needs.

“We are truly grateful to the OPM for standing with the people of Soroti during this difficult time. These iron sheets will be used strictly for the intended purposes to ensure the affected institutions and individuals get the relief they need,” said Mr. Esatu.

Also present at the handover ceremony was the Assistant Resident District Commissioner (RDC) of Soroti, Mr. Victor Mutai, who expressed appreciation for the government’s timely intervention.

He noted that several schools, churches, and individuals had earlier written to the district leadership seeking help after the destruction of their buildings.

“This support is a result of the appeals made through the district to the OPM. We are happy that the government listened and responded quickly. These iron sheets will help restore the roofs of schools, churches, and homes that were severely affected,” Mr. Mutai said.

He further emphasized the importance of ensuring that the donated materials reach the intended beneficiaries without diversion, adding that local authorities would closely monitor the distribution and use.

The donation is part of the government’s broader disaster response and recovery program, aimed at helping communities rebuild after natural calamities.
